How much money did AMC raise in 2020?

Yet, the company staved off insolvency by raising $917 million in new capital, including $506 million from investors who purchased AMC shares. As of the end of 2020, AMC operated over 10,500 screens around the world.

How many theaters does AMC have?

Founded in 1920, AMC Theatres owns or operates 950 theaters in 14 different countries. Based in Leawood, Kansas, the company introduced multiplex theaters in the 1960s and stadium-seating in the 1990s.

How to buy stock when you have decided how much?

Once you have decided how much stock you wish to purchase, you can use a market order or limit order to execute the buy. A market order will purchase the next available shares at whatever price the stock is currently trading. With a limit order, you can set the maximum price you’re willing to pay for shares. Is AMC going public?

Financial Profile of AMC. AMC Theatres, which went public in 2013, posted modest gains in top line revenue between 2017 and 2019. But the coronavirus pandemic brought the company to the brink of bankruptcy in 2020, as it temporarily closed all of its theaters by March 17.

How many theaters are closed in 2020?

Limited operations resumed both domestically and internationally, but revenue dropped 77% in 2020 and 63 theaters closed permanently, according to AMC’s Form 10-K. Yet, the company staved off insolvency by raising $917 million in new capital, including $506 million from investors who purchased AMC shares.

AMC Entertainment Group ( AMC -5.30% ) has many investors curious. The stock inspires many headlines, and AMC is a source of frequent discussion on social media sites and discussion forums.

Why AMC stock keeps climbing higher

First, it's important to note the company's rising stock price has little to do with its operating performance. AMC's business was devastated during the pandemic. While it is slowly bouncing back, the company is still losing money every quarter. There is no telling when or if the company will generate profits on the bottom line.

NYSE: AMC

Rather, its stock price is rising due to a large group of individuals collectively deciding to buy and hold the stock. Like many financial assets, when the demand goes up, the price moves in the same direction.

Looking at AMC's operating performance

Since AMC generates nearly all of its revenue from people visiting theaters in person, the coronavirus pandemic was a catastrophe. What's more, AMC still had to come up with the rent payments on its theaters and interest payments to its lenders. Management has since negotiated some delays to those payments, but they are still accumulating.

Customer value proposition

A confluence of factors has fewer people visiting movie theaters to watch films. From 2002 to 2019, tickets sold to view movies at the box office in the U.S. and Canada decreased from 1.58 billion to 1.24 billion.

The verdict

The current operating environment for AMC is severely constrained, with a deadly virus still in circulation. Over the longer run, the secular popularity of streaming services and the increasing quality of the home viewing experience is bad news for AMC.
